Cloghboola Beg

Date Added: 18th Sep 2010
Site Type: Stone Circle Country: Ireland (Republic of) (Co. Cork)
Visited: Yes on 24th May 2010

Cloghboola Beg

Cloghboola Beg submitted by frogcottage42 on 24th May 2010. This is probably the best preserved radial stone cairn in the SW. There are 19 stones standing and a couple prostrate. This view from the West shows one of the fallen stones of a row and the five stone monument at the left

Millstreet Country Park

Date Added: 18th Sep 2010
Site Type: Museum Country: Ireland (Republic of) (Co. Cork)
Visited: Yes on 24th May 2010

Millstreet Country Park

Millstreet Country Park submitted by frogcottage42 on 24th May 2010. This is described as a shepherds hut and has been partially restored It is typical of the sensible approach the park have taken to reconstruction. This is marked on OS and the bottom courses of stone are prehistoric.
